Abstract

PURPOSE:To attain the detection of superimposed call even when a superimposed signal is lower than an echo signal in level and an echo signal level is low by using an output level rather than an input level to detect the level of the transmission side signal. CONSTITUTION:An attenuation measuring circuit 10 obtains the sum of the echo loss and the echo cancelling amount based on the outputs of two measuring circuit 8, 9 (the value is obtained from the ratio of the reception side signal level to the remaining erasure echo level). A reception signal level estimation value operating circuit 11 obtains an estimate value of the reception signal level from the level of the measured attenuation and the remaining erasure echo level measured by the attenuation measuring circuit 10 (obtained by multiplying both the levels). The estimate value and the value whose level is measured by a reception signal level estimate section 9 are compared by a comparator circuit 12. The decrease in the echo cancelling amount is prevented due to correction, stop or correcting speed reduction of an echo path model of the echo cancelling section by using the comparator output.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ION The present invention relates to an echo control device for eliminating echoes in a communication circuit.

Conventionally, echo blocking devices, voice switches, echo canceling devices, etc. have been used to control echoes from long-distance lines, door extension telephones, two-way repeaters, etc. The first two of these have problems such as disconnection at the beginning of the line and click noise when turning the line on and off, and the second echo canceling device uses the echo blocking device and other devices described above. It was developed to compensate for the drawbacks of voice switches. This device measures the echo path, synthesizes the echo signal and an approximate echo signal based on the measured echo path characteristics, and thereby eliminates the actual echo signal, resulting in cutting off the beginning of speech and clicking noise. It does not have a mechanism that causes such problems.

However, in the case of this echo cancellation device, in its basic configuration, when the echo signal is superimposed with the transmission signal, noise, etc. and input to the transmission side input, the measurement accuracy of the echo path decreases, and the amount of echo cancellation decreases. It has a predisposition to decrease to a value determined by the ratio of the echo signal level of the transmitting side input to the other signal level. Therefore, in order to prevent the amount of echo cancellation from decreasing in this superimposed state, a superimposed speech detection circuit has been used in practice. However, since this superimposed call detection is performed by comparing the receiving side signal level and the sending side signal level, it is detected when the superimposed signal level is smaller than the echo signal level, or when the echo signal level is small, the superimposed call is detected. had the disadvantage of being impossible.

Therefore, an object of the present invention is to provide an echo cancellation device that can detect a superimposed call even when the superimposed signal level is small relative to the echo signal level and when the echo signal level is small, and can prevent a decrease in anti-threat cancellation. In order to achieve the above object, the present invention detects the level of the transmitter signal at the output level rather than at the input level, and accordingly adds necessary circuitry.

The attenuation measurement circuit 10 calculates the sum of the echo path loss and the amount of echo cancellation based on the outputs of the two measurement circuits 8 and 9 (this value depends on the ratio of the receiving side signal level and the cancellation residual echo level). . In other words, the loss characteristic from the no-bridder circuit 14 to the terminal 3 is defined as LA (echo path loss),
If the loss characteristic from to the measurement circuit 8 is LB (echo cancellation amount), then the relationship between the reception (g) and the residual echo signal e is expressed as e.
= LA e LB ·R. Therefore, the loss characteristic from the terminal 2 to which the reception signal R is input to the measurement circuit 8 is represented by ■. This value always increases when there is no superimposed signal, but
When there is a superimposed signal, it becomes the sum of the superimposed signal and the cancellation residual signal, and it appears as if the cancellation residual echo has increased, which can be mistakenly interpreted as a decrease in the sum of the echo path loss and the amount of echo cancellation. . In order to prevent malfunctions due to this superimposed signal, the attenuation measuring circuit 10 compares the previously used value and the currently measured value as the attenuation value, and uses the larger value. However, if the value of this attenuation amount is decreased over time, the stability of the device will improve.

The received signal level estimated value calculation circuit 11 is the attenuation measurement circuit 1
The estimated value of the received signal level is calculated from the level of the attenuation amount measured at 0 and the level of the canceled residual echo (determined by multiplying both levels). Comparing this estimated value with the level measured by the received signal level estimating section 9 using the comparing circuit 12, it is found that when there is a superimposed signal, the signal level of the canceled residual echo level measuring circuit 8 increases as described above. The value of the received signal level measurement circuit 9 becomes smaller than the output of the received signal level estimated value calculation circuit 11. This comparator output can prevent a decrease in the amount of echo cancellation by modifying, stopping, or slowing down the modification speed of the echo path model of the echo canceller 5. Also, when comparing using the comparator circuit 12, the receiving signal level measuring section 9
Alternatively, the operation can be stabilized by adding a constant to the estimated received signal value. In this device, the canceled residual echo level measuring circuit 8, the raft-shaped amount measuring circuit 10, and the received signal level estimated value calculation circuit 11 may be collectively named the received signal level estimator 13.
